亲和膜色谱   总被引:1,自引:0,他引:1  
亲和膜色谱又称亲和膜分离,其在蛋白质的分离纯化中作为一种综合性的技术出现在80年代末。亲和膜色谱主要优点是克服了颗粒状多孔载体扩散传质阻力大的缺点,代之以对流传质,这样就可以在较低的操作压和较高的流速下对目标蛋白进行快速的分离和纯化,从而缩短操作时间、提高纯化效率。本文将就近年来亲和膜色谱及其在蛋白质分离和纯化中的应用作一综述性介绍。  相似文献

染料膜亲和色谱法中膜堆的制备及应用   总被引:5,自引:1,他引:4  
郭为  商振华  于亿年  周良模 《色谱》1996,14(3):168-171
将染料亲和配基偶联于大孔纤维素膜上,所得亲和膜用胶粘法制成亲和膜堆,膜堆的通透性远优于通常的亲和色谱柱。装有蓝色和红色亲和膜的膜堆可分别用于人血清白蛋白和碱性磷酸酯酶的分离纯化,其中碱性磷酸酯酶可在一步操作后纯化40倍。  相似文献

The Langevin paramagnetic theory can’t describe the relation between magnetization of ferrofluids and applied magnetic field. The structuralization of ferrofluids, which is considered the main influence factor of the magnetization, is regarded. The part of magnetization works is deposited when the structure is forming. This action influences the magnetization of ferrofluids directly or indirectly. On the base of the “compressing” model, the Langevin function that usually describes the magnetization of ferrofluid is modified, and a well-fitted curve is obtained. An equation of the relation between the equivalent volume fraction after being “compressed” and the intensity of magnetic field is discovered, which approximately describes the process of magnetization. The relation between the approximate initial susceptibility and the volume fraction can be obtained from modified formula.  相似文献
